Memory foam is a good Christmas investment, a bedding expert has said, with aching backs and bodies being cured by the comfortable qualities of the material - something which may come in handy for the heavy bags on Christmas shopping trips.
People wanting to treat themselves to a great night's sleep this Christmas should invest in memory foam, an industry blogger has said.A person's mattress is "absolutely crucial" in their comfort levels says Rebecca, a writer for design specialist Essential Interiors.
She added that mattresses should be changed every eight to ten years and memory foam is a perfect way to indulge a body in the festive period.
Rebecca noted that a bad mattress is a big contributor to aching bodies and pulled muscles as well as a poorer quality of sleep.
"By responding to your body's contours, your weight and pressure distribution will most definitely be improved. It is this distribution that will prevent aches, pulls and general 'feeling rubbish'," she added.
Fitness trainer Fitz K recently shared her love for memory foam, telling That's Fit that the material showed her how uncomfortably she used to sleep before getting one.
